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
Place the hot dogs in a skillet and cook over medium heat, turning occasionally, for about 6 minutes or until they are browned and heated through.
While the hot dogs are cooking, carefully cut the sugar-free hot dog buns open, if not pre-sliced.
Spread a small amount of butter on the inside of each bun to add flavor and prevent sticking.
Place the buns on a baking sheet.
Once the hot dogs are cooked, place one hot dog inside each bun.
Top each hot dog with a slice of cheddar cheese.
Place the baking sheet in the preheated oven and bake for about 4 minutes or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
Remove from the oven and allow to cool slightly.
Drizzle each hot dog with 1 teaspoon of yellow mustard and 1 teaspoon of mayonnaise.
Sprinkle the chopped green onions over the top for extra flavor and garnish.
Season with a pinch of salt and black pepper according to taste.
Serve immediately and enjoy your low carb cheesy hot dogs!
